Florida Senior Azalea: Doug Hanzel wins by two
3/13/2016 | by AmateurGolf.com Staff

see also: View results for Florida Azalea Senior, Palatka Golf Club

Doug Hanzel
Doug Hanzel

Doug Hanzel matched a field-best score with a 3-under 67 to win his first title of the year by two stokes

PALATKA, FL (March 13, 2016)--Doug Hanzel (Savannah, GA) broke free of a three-way tie at the beginning of the final round to win the Florida Senior Azalea. Hanzel fired a final round, 3-under 67 at the Palatka Golf Club to win with a score 1-under par.

Doug Snoap (Apopka, FL) finished two strokes behind at 1-over par. Snoap was able to rebound from a first round 4-over 74 to shoot an even-par 70 and a 3-under 67.

Hanzel playing in just his second AmateurGolf.com ranking event of the year picked up his first win of the 2016 season. The 2015 Senior Player-of-the-Year was 2-over through the first two rounds after a pair of 71's before his field-best matching 3-under score.

Randy Elliot (Winter Park, FL) and John Fritz (Charlotte, NC) both struggled on the final day after being tied for the lead at the start of the day. The duo each shot 2-over par 72 to tie for third.

Denny Taylor (Gladstone, OR) finished in fifth place with a three round total of 4-over par.


Legends Division

In the Legends Division Jim Carley (75, 68, 71) blitzed the field winning by five stokes. Carley finished 4-over par for the tournament.

Brian Sachs (9-over) finished second and William Liberato (15-over) finished in third place.

About the Florida Azalea Senior

54 hole stroke play championship with Senior (ages 55+), Super Senior (ages 64-69), Legends (ages 70- 74) and Super Legends (ages 75+) divisions. Players will be grouped into six flights by handicap. After 36 holes the Championship flight will be cut...
